By Richard and Jonny Staley. We are a family dry stone walling business based in Cumbria. As brothers we pool ideas and resources to offer a wide range of walling skills. We undertake work in Cumbria, North Yorkshire and the North Pennine regions and are therefore used to varied types of stone and regional differences in construction methods, such as smout holes, culverts and stiles. Dry stone walls are a common feature in many parts of the UK, especially in the North of England, and are one of the oldest forms of field and property boundaries. There is evidence of their existence as far back as the Iron Age. As history progressed their popularity increased and they are now also used as garden boundaries, retaining walls, landscaping features, shelters and even sculptures.
